Designed by a famous french architect, Patinage de Verre is an open aired skating rink combining classical and modern architectural designs to create a one of a kind experience. With the glass roof and two story glass wall looking out to the small fountain plaza, Patinage de Verre is lit mainly by sunlight, with many small lights mounted onto the walls for decoration and late night skaters. Whether you want to soar freely on the ice, sip some coffee from the cafe on the second floor, or just soak up sun outside by the fountain, Patinage de Verre has something for anyone and is a great place to spend the day.


Lot Size: 4x5
Lot Price: §290,671
